Unlocking Creative Flow: Strategies for a Thriving Work-Life Balance



The pursuit of a balanced life is a universal aspiration, yet for creative professionals, this equilibrium can often feel elusive. The deeply personal and often all-consuming nature of creative work frequently blurs the lines between professional and personal life. This article provides practical strategies to help creatives cultivate a more sustainable and fulfilling lifestyle, enabling them to thrive both personally and professionally.



Setting Healthy Boundaries: Prioritizing Well-being



Establishing clear boundaries is paramount for creative success and overall well-being. Defining specific working hours and adhering to them, even when inspiration strikes, is crucial. While passion fuels creative endeavors, adequate rest and rejuvenation are equally vital. Self-care is not a luxury; it's a necessity. Integrating activities such as exercise, meditation, mindful breathing techniques, or quality time with loved ones into your daily routine nourishes your well-being and enhances your creative output. A well-rested and balanced artist is a more productive and inspired artist.



Crafting an Ideal Creative Sanctuary: Goal Setting for Success



Creating a dedicated workspace significantly improves focus and facilitates a smoother transition into a productive work mindset. Whether it's a home studio, a quiet corner in a shared space, or a co-working environment, establishing a sanctuary where you can fully immerse yourself in your craft is essential. Equally important is setting realistic and attainable goals. Break down large, ambitious projects into smaller, manageable tasks with achievable deadlines. This strategy prevents overwhelm, fosters a sense of accomplishment, and promotes a consistent workflow.



The Art of Saying No: Embracing Flexibility and Prioritization



Mastering the art of saying no is a crucial skill for creatives. While collaborations and new opportunities are enticing, it’s essential to recognize your limitations and prioritize projects that align with your long-term goals and overall well-being. Creatives often benefit from flexible work arrangements; leverage this freedom to structure your work around your personal life and commitments. This might involve intense bursts of focused work interspersed with periods of rest, or a more adaptable schedule that accommodates personal appointments and family time.



Digital Detox and Community Connection: Reclaiming Your Time and Energy



In our hyper-connected world, intentional disconnection is vital for mental clarity and well-being. Establish tech-free zones and designated times throughout the day to recharge and focus on other aspects of your life. Engage actively with your creative community. Connecting with like-minded individuals provides invaluable support, shared experiences, and a sense of belonging—all crucial elements for maintaining balance and preventing feelings of isolation. Participating in workshops, online forums, or local artist groups can provide a powerful sense of community and shared purpose.



Diversifying Passions: Scheduling Downtime for Renewal



Cultivating hobbies and interests outside your primary creative pursuit provides essential respite, sparks inspiration, and offers fresh perspectives that enrich your artistic process. Engaging in activities unrelated to your professional work allows you to return to your creative endeavors with renewed energy and a fresh outlook. Regular downtime is not a luxury, but a fundamental necessity. Schedule vacations, days off, or even short breaks for relaxation and rejuvenation. Prioritizing rest replenishes your creative wellspring, enhancing both your productivity and overall well-being.



Delegation, Routine, and Time Mastery: Optimizing Your Workflow



Recognize your limitations and don't hesitate to delegate or outsource tasks that fall outside your core competencies. This frees up valuable time and energy to focus on your strengths and the aspects of your work that bring you the most fulfillment. Establishing a daily routine, even a flexible one, provides structure and balance. Experiment with time management techniques, such as the Pomodoro Technique or time-blocking, to optimize focus and minimize burnout. These strategies help to create a sustainable workflow that integrates your personal and professional life harmoniously.



Continuous Reflection and Adaptation: Navigating the Evolving Landscape



Regularly reflect on your work-life balance and reassess your priorities. Life is dynamic; what works effectively at one point in time may not be sustainable in the long term. Remain adaptable and make necessary adjustments to your routines and strategies as your needs evolve. This continuous process of self-assessment and adaptation is key to maintaining a healthy and fulfilling balance.



Embrace the Creative Journey: Finding Fulfillment in the Process



Ultimately, enjoy the creative process. Creative work is a privilege, not a burden. Embrace both the highs and lows, celebrate your successes, and find joy in the journey itself. Achieving work-life balance isn't about strict adherence to a rigid formula; it's about holistic fulfillment—finding satisfaction and joy in all aspects of your life.
